What is a Raspberry Pi Management Platform?
A Raspberry Pi management platform is a software solution designed to simplify the administration and monitoring of multiple Raspberry Pi devices. These platforms provide a centralized interface where users can manage configurations, deploy updates, monitor performance, and troubleshoot issues without needing to interact with each device individually. They are particularly useful for users managing large-scale deployments, such as IoT networks, educational institutions, or businesses leveraging Raspberry Pi for automation.
Most platforms come equipped with features like remote access, real-time analytics, and automated backups. These functionalities ensure that your Raspberry Pi devices remain operational and secure, even in complex environments. For instance, if you're running a smart home system powered by Raspberry Pi, a management platform can help you monitor energy usage, control devices remotely, and receive alerts for potential issues.

How Does a Raspberry Pi Management Platform Work?
A Raspberry Pi management platform operates by connecting to your devices via the internet or a local network. Once connected, the platform collects data from each Raspberry Pi, such as system performance metrics, network activity, and application statuses. This information is then displayed on a user-friendly dashboard, allowing you to monitor and manage your devices from a single location.
The platform typically uses APIs or custom agents installed on each Raspberry Pi to facilitate communication. These agents ensure that commands issued through the platform are executed correctly on the target devices. For example, if you want to roll out a new software update across all your Raspberry Pi units, the platform will handle the distribution and installation process automatically.

Can a Raspberry Pi Management Platform Improve Security?
Yes, a Raspberry Pi management platform can significantly enhance the security of your devices. By automating updates and patches, these platforms ensure that vulnerabilities are addressed promptly. Additionally, many platforms offer advanced security features such as two-factor authentication, role-based access control, and threat detection systems.
For example, if a new security threat emerges, the platform can automatically apply patches to all connected devices, reducing the risk of exploitation. This proactive approach to security is crucial for protecting sensitive data and maintaining the integrity of your Raspberry Pi projects.
